A note about YouTube videos.
Since YouTube is the big kid on campus, and you’ll probably spend a lot of time there researching, it’s important to note that the “view” number may seriously skewed by mentions on traditional media, links to popular websites, the age of the video or other “campaigns” implemented to boost the count. A site or video that is promoted to the front page of social news site Digg.com, for example, can get pummeled with a million hits, but the traffic is best described as “non-converting.” Users come for the content in droves, but they don’t don’t buy or even click around! If you’re Coke or Pepsi, this might be fine. You’ll add it to the “branding” line in your budget and call it a day, but we’re talking about driving clicks that count!
3 ways to using viral videos to drive quality traffic at a low cost.
- Benefit Driven Videos: Providing specific value to current & potential customers through “How to videos” or Podcasts is a great way to gain traction with your ideal customer! If you really know your customers, this one’s almost a no-brainer!
- User Generated Content: This is usually done with contesting of some type, perhaps with a product or other motivating factor can energize users and compel them to upload their own videos per your request. If the prize is interesting enough, this could create quite a bit of buzz for your brand!
- Loud Cheap Different: Look very closely at all of your current videos, your competitors videos as well as everything you can find related to your category on YouTube and everywhere else. Then run the other way! Create something totally insanely different! Ensure that it stands out! Totally focus on creating a video geared solely toward making an impact on your target customer and, to ensure that this video “gets traction,” plan on promoting it using a keyword buys! Prepare to be loud & brash or prepare for disappointment!
As in any Word of Mouth Marketing campaign, the key to a successful viral video is in the impact it makes on customers. Viral videos need to drive emotion or offer significant value in order to be spread from person to person, but they do not need to be expensive to produce!
